Property description & features

  • Town centre location
  • Gross internal area approx. 124.9 sq m (1,344 sq ft)
  • £17,500 per annum exclusive
  • 7 office rooms
  • 5 allocated car parking spaces
The premises comprises a self-contained first floor office which is accessed via a staircase which leads from a ground floor entrance fronting Vicarage Road. The property provides the following specification:

- Seven office rooms
- Reception area
- Separate staircase entrance to the rear
- Lighting
- Two WC's
- Gas fired central heating
- Carpeted
- Power and data points
- Five allocated car parking spaces

Verwood is a popular Dorset town located approximately 5 miles to the north west of Ringwood providing good access to the A31 trunk road linking to both Bournemouth and Southampton. The town has experienced considerable population growth over
the last few years. The property is situated on Vicarage Road, an established trading location in the Town Centre.

The property is available by means of a new full repairing and insuring lease for a
term to be agreed.

£17,500 per annum exclusive.

The rent is payable quarterly in advance and is exclusive of; business rates, service
charge, utilities, insurance and VAT.

A service charge will be payable in respect of upkeep, management and
maintenance of common parts within the building. Further details are
available upon request.

The Valuation Office Agency states that the property has a rateable value of £10,500.
The Rates Payable will be determined by the Uniform Business Rate Multiplier which is
set by the Government annually. Rates payable may also be subject to transitional or
small business rates relief and interested parties are therefore encouraged to contact
the Local Rating Authority directly.

    Broadband availability and predicted speed

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2
